Last Tuesday we had a service project at Feed My Starving Children, a great volunteer organization that bags and ships nutritious meals to hungry kids in third world countries. The volunteers worked as food baggers, each person scooping a different part of the meal into a bag to later be brought into the warehouse to be shipped. The volunteers packed 83 boxes, which is a total of 17, 928 bags packed. These meals will be able to feed 49 children for a year.
